There’s no need to change to 4.3 if everything is ok in 4.2. tvh server needs stability, some will find it in 4.2 others in 4.3. there are setups that need one or another exclusively. That’s why they’re both available in the repo. Before that, if someone loaded tvh 4.3 from other builds it would update 4.2. Some people will have service.tvheadend42 running as 4.3 if they changed version before 4.3 being available in our repo.
